Monee Elementary School

25425 S Will Center Rd
Monee, IL 60449

Serving 376 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Monee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Illinois for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 11% (which is lower than the Illinois state average of 27%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 17% (which is lower than the Illinois state average of 30%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is equal to the Illinois state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 78%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Illinois state average of 55% (majority Hispanic and Black).
